Mackay detectives have charged a local man with ten offences following investigations into two serious crashes last Sunday (November 20) at Mount Pleasant and Farleigh. Initial information indicates shortly after 6.30am on Sunday, two vehicles collided at the intersection of the Bruce Highway and Sams Road before one of the vehicles, a stolen white Toyota Landcruiser, left the scene.

Connection and camaraderie were front and centre on Saturday when Mackay’s emergency services came together for Mackay Fire & Rescue's Annual 60km Swim Challenge. Now in its third year, this year’s challenge was the first to pit the services against each other and while there was a competitive element to the day, the ultimate goal was to break the stigma surrounding men's mental health, a topic prevalent in the first response world.

On the morning of Saturday, March 17, 1962, residents of Townsville awoke to find a peculiar figure painted atop their beloved Castle Hill. It wasn’t the first time an out of place painting appeared on the hill as university students had painted a question mark there the year before, which had since been painted over.

North Queensland Bulk Ports Corporation (NQBP) has completed major infrastructure works at the Port of Mackay with the completion of Wharf Five. The Port’s newest wharf now boasts a $4 million western approach deck, positioning the Port to continue to take advantage of future trade opportunities.
